This video was filmed for the virtual Earth Day Fair in Winston-Salem, N.C., by the Piedmont Environmental Alliance, The virtual tour was facilitated by Campus Lab Manager, Nathan Peifer. Madeline Coffey ('17) from the Piedmont Environmental Alliance (PEA) joins Nathan to ask questions about backyard composting, volunteer opportunities, backyard beekeeping, and more. The Wake Forest Campus Garden is a demonstration space for regenerative agriculture and engaged learning at Wake Forest University. The space is utilized by faculty across all disciplines to introduce students to varying processes in the garden and connect those processes to their course material.
